Maintenance Technician

Summary Maintenance Technicians are responsible for keeping machines in good working conditions to enhance efficiency and prevent malfunctions that could lead to costly repairs.

To do this, the associate is responsible for performing highly diversified duties to install, troubleshoot, repair and maintain production and facility equipment according to safety, preventive and productive maintenance systems and processes to support the achievement of the sites business goals and objectives.

Duties and Responsibilities Create and manage work orders in L2L, conducting necessary maintenance or repairs as needed.

Diagnose mechanical problems and determine how to correct them, checking blueprints, repair manuals or parts catalogs as necessary.

Perform routine maintenance, such as inspecting drives, motors or belts, checking fluid levels, replacing filters or doing other preventive maintenance actions.

Provide emergency/unscheduled repairs of production equipment during production and performs scheduled maintenance repairs of production equipment during machine service.

Basic electrical troubleshooting, including replacement of three phase motors.

Installation of equipment and piping; setting up production lines.

Troubleshoot and repair pneumatic devices and hydraulic systems.

Rebuilding gearboxes and drives.

Repair and troubleshooting of filling lines.

Repair machines, equipment or structures, using tools such as hammers, hoists, saws, drills, wrenches or equipment such as precision measuring instruments or electrical or electronic testing devices.

Maintain constant communication with Plant Management regarding any maintenance issues that may arise so that Plant Management can adjust their production schedule accordingly.

Assist in the setup and teardown of machines and equipment at beginning and end of shifts.

Liaise with Production and Quality departments to ensure highest level of quality is achieved after any intervention and throughout the working life of equipment.

Provides feedback to the Management team to share ideas and improve operation.

Recommends, supports and implements continuous improvement activities, processes, and procedure improvements to optimize results and improve quality of delivery.

Use Reference Resources such as work books and drawings, technical manuals, understanding of industrial equipment, and careful observation to discover the cause of a problem Proactively identify, assess and determine appropriate controls for Safety related issues; influence other associates to identify and resolve Safety related issues.

Demonstrates general understanding of industrial safety practices and regulations, and in particular such topics as: Lock-out/Tag-out procedures, Fall protection, Personal protective equipment, and all other mandatory safety procedures related to the job.

Actively Participates on the Safety Committee.

Participates in Root Cause Analysis (RCA) sessions in problem solving projects.
